Protecting Your Hearing While You Work: Best Dentist Earplugs
oral professionals work in noisy environments daily. Long-term exposure to these sounds can lead to hearing damage. Thankfully, there are effective earplug options available specifically designed for dentists.
These specialized earplugs are designed to reduce the harmful level of dental tools and patient chatter without affecting your ability to communicate. A good pair of dentist earplugs offers a comfortable fit, clear sound transmission for essential communication, and long-lasting safety.
Here are some key considerations to keep in mind when choosing earplugs for your dental practice:
- Noise Reduction Rating (NRR): Higher NRR means greater noise attenuation.
- Fit and Comfort: Choose earplugs that adapt to your ears comfortably for a secure seal.
- Material: Consider hypoallergenic materials if you have sensitive skin.
By investing in the right earplugs, you can safeguard your hearing and enjoy a safer, healthier work environment.
